a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orTed Gould <ted@canonical.com>2009-05-20 12:17:25 +0200
committerTed Gould <ted@canonical.com>2009-05-20 12:17:25 +0200
commit039c05e5e8961e1eac265a7a073526a2257d6665 (patch)
tree22c5290d2774d086cf2e442c6f7120279102e70c
parent1df52c61f44b049b9e023a139a558b9e835ad5f7 (diff)
downloadlibdbusmenu-039c05e5e8961e1eac265a7a073526a2257d6665.tar.gz
libdbusmenu-039c05e5e8961e1eac265a7a073526a2257d6665.tar.bz2
libdbusmenu-039c05e5e8961e1eac265a7a073526a2257d6665.zip
Comments on the structures along with some reserved entries.
-rw-r--r--libdbusmenu-gtk/menu.h18
1 files changed, 18 insertions, 0 deletions
diff --git a/libdbusmenu-gtk/menu.h b/libdbusmenu-gtk/menu.h
index 96dcca2..34def17 100644
--- a/libdbusmenu-gtk/menu.h
+++ b/libdbusmenu-gtk/menu.h
@@ -13,11 +13,29 @@ G_BEGIN_DECLS
#define DBUSMENU_IS_GTKMENU_CLASS(klass) (G_TYPE_CHECK_CLASS_TYPE ((klass), DBUSMENU_GTKMENU_TYPE))
#define DBUSMENU_GTKMENU_GET_CLASS(obj) (G_TYPE_INSTANCE_GET_CLASS ((obj), DBUSMENU_GTKMENU_TYPE, DbusmenuGtkMenuClass))
+/**
+ DbusmenuGtkMenuClass:
+ @parent_class: #GtkMenuClass
+ @reserved1: Reserved for future use.
+ @reserved2: Reserved for future use.
+ @reserved3: Reserved for future use.
+ @reserved4: Reserved for future use.
+*/
typedef struct _DbusmenuGtkMenuClass DbusmenuGtkMenuClass;
struct _DbusmenuGtkMenuClass {
GtkMenuClass parent_class;
+
+ /* Reserved */
+ void (*reserved1) (void);
+ void (*reserved2) (void);
+ void (*reserved3) (void);
+ void (*reserved4) (void);
};
+/**
+ DbusmenuGtkMenu:
+ @parent: #GtkMenu
+*/
typedef struct _DbusmenuGtkMenu DbusmenuGtkMenu;
struct _DbusmenuGtkMenu {
GtkMenu parent;